Is the BMW 8 Series a good car?

Yes — the BMW 8 Series is a strong choice if you want a luxury grand tourer with style and performance at the center of its appeal. The all-generations owner rating is 4.59/5 across every model year in the data. Owners consistently praise its sporty performance, luxurious design, advanced technology, and strong handling, while styling is another recurring highlight. Expert reviews rate the 2020 and 2021 models among the highest across all years. The main trade-offs across recent expert-tested years center on interior quality that can feel basic for a luxury car, a cramped rear seat, and high upkeep costs on older V12 models. 31.9% of listings are priced as good or great deals.

Are BMW 8 Series models reliable?

Owners consistently rate the BMW 8 Series highly, and the recurring praise centers on its performance, handling, styling, and premium driving experience. Expert feedback also reinforces the model’s strong road manners and upscale character.

  • Owners rate the BMW 8 Series between 4.2 and 5.0 out of 5 stars across all model years in the data.

For used buyers, long-term ownership risk is mainly tied to upkeep costs and the premium nature of the car, so a well-documented service history matters.

Which BMW 8 Series trim should I buy?

The 2023 BMW 8 Series offers these trims:

  • 840i: The entry point brings the 3.0-liter turbocharged inline-six, 335 horsepower, 368 pound-feet of torque, and an eight-speed automatic. It suits you if you want the core 8 Series experience with the most approachable powertrain.
  • 840i xDrive: This version adds all-wheel drive to the 840i formula, giving you the same six-cylinder setup with extra traction.
  • M850i xDrive: This trim adds the 4.4-liter twin-turbo V8 with 523 hp and 553 lb-ft of torque, plus the AWD-only setup. It’s the best-value step-up if you want a major performance jump.
  • M8 Competition: This trim adds 617 hp and 553 lb-ft of torque, an M-specific eight-speed automatic, and AWD. It’s the choice for maximum performance.
  • Alpina B8 Gran Coupe: This version adds 612 hp, a 3.3-second zero-to-60 time, and a more luxurious character. It suits you if you want high performance with a grand-touring focus.
